Serbia: Navracsics in Belgrade for a meeting on education

Commissioner opens annual ministerial meeting, focus on research

28 September, 10:03
(ANSA) - BRUXELLES - The European Commissioner for Education, Culture, Youth and Sport, Tibor Navracsics, will be in Belgrade today to open the annual ministerial meeting of the Western Balkans Platform on Education and Training. All the six ministers of Education from the region will attend the meeting to review the state of educational reforms in their countries, learn about the latest strategies in the EU, identify challenges, and discuss deeper cooperation. This year the meeting will focus on the region's research capacity and mobility opportunities, the European Commission points out in its daily review. "Since its launch in 2012, the Western Balkans Ministerial Platform has become a valuable tradition" to exchange views on the situation and identify "priorities" for the region, Commissioner Navracsics says. The Commissioner will also attend a panel debate on the impact of Erasmus+ with alumni who have benefitted from the programme in recent years. (ANSA).
